  A funny album of alternative lyrics and new material
Review created: 07/03/08
by:
1 of 1 people found this review helpful.

If you've never heard any of the Barron Knights' material then this is the perfect way to introduce yourself to some of their best songs. They have been around since the dawn of time re-writing the words to songs that you thought you knew and loved.

I particularly love some of the original material such as "Get down Shep" and "The Hand to the ear folksong". This shows that the band can play and entertain to a wide audience.

If you're feeling in need of something a little bit lighter to listen to then this is an exceptional album which will keep you giggling for a very long time.
